Abstract
A view mechanism can provide a user with an appropriate portion of a database through data filtering and aggregation. Views are often materialized for query performance improvement, and in that case, their consistency needs to be maintained against updates of the underlying data. They can be either recomputed or incrementally refreshed by reflecting only the relevant updates. With the emergence of XML as the standard for data exchange on the Web, active research is under way on efficient storing and querying of XML documents with the DBMS. In this paper, we investigate the materialization of XML views and their incremental refresh for the case of a restricted class of views. The object-relational DBMS is employed to store XML documents and their materialized views, and the update log is used for deferred view refresh. Algorithms for checking a logged update's relevance to a view and for generating the optimized SQL statements to refresh the materialized view stored in an object-relational database through scanning of the update log are described. Experimental results show that our approach can be very effective in providing views of a large-scale XML warehouse on the Web.
